
MANILA – College of Saint Benilde Blazers tightened their hold on the top spot of the NCAA Season 100 men’s basketball after an 80-65 rout of Jose Rizal University Heavy Bombers on Sunday at the Filoil EcoOil Center in San Juan.
Ian Torres provided spark off the bench, finishing with 16 points, two assists, two steals, and one rebound as the Blazers stayed on top with a 10-2 win-loss slate.
Allen Liwag poured in a double-double of 12 markers and 11 boards alongside three dimes and one swat, while Justine Sanchez tallied 10 markers for the Blazers.
“Kami naman we play every team the same way, that’s how we treat the NCAA, we respect every team. JRU is a good team, they’re always tough,” Blazers head coach Charles Tiu said after the match.
He added: “They always play every team close, they’ve had a few games na natalo lang sa dulo. So we wanted to make sure we have breathing room and just play our game,” he added.
Joshua Guiab paced the Heavy Bombers with 17 points, three rebounds, three assists, and two steals while Shawn Argente and MJ Raymundo chimed in with 14 and 13 markers each. They dropped to a 3-9 mark.
Meanwhile, Mapua University Cardinals overcame a tough stand by San Beda University Red Lions for a 58-55 escape in a rematch of NCAA Season 99 finalists.
Rookie Chris Hubilla stepped up offensively with 17 points to go with nine rebounds, while Marc Cuenco added 10 markers as the Cardinals improved to a 10-3 win-loss slate for solo second place.
Clint Escamis, the reigning NCAA MVP, struggled for the second straight game with seven points, on 3-of-15 shooting, to go with two assists, two steals, and a rebound for Mapua.
Ilonggo John Bryan Sajonia top-scored for the reigning champions Red Lions with 12 points, while Jomel Puno added 11 markers. They dropped to an 8-5 win-loss card./PN
